The Impact of Live Video in International Diplomacy

In today's hyper-connected world, the role of live video in international diplomacy has become increasingly significant, and a hypothetical live video Trump Zelensky interaction exemplifies this trend. Gone are the days when high-level political discussions were solely confined to formal state visits or closed-door meetings. Live video conferencing platforms have democratized and accelerated diplomatic communication, allowing for real-time engagement between leaders across vast distances. This immediacy offers several advantages. Firstly, it allows for rapid responses to unfolding crises. Imagine a sudden escalation in a conflict; a live video Trump Zelensky could be convened quickly to assess the situation, coordinate strategies, and issue joint statements, potentially de-escalating tensions or rallying international support more effectively than traditional diplomatic channels. The ability to see and hear each other in real-time adds a layer of personal connection and urgency that written communiques or even recorded messages lack.

Moreover, live video facilitates a more direct and unfiltered form of communication. While diplomats and advisors play crucial roles, a direct conversation between leaders can cut through bureaucratic red tape and convey nuanced intentions more clearly. For leaders like Trump, who thrives on direct engagement, or Zelensky, who needs to convey the urgency of his nation's plight, live video is an ideal medium. It allows them to bypass potentially biased media filters and speak directly to each other and, by extension, to the global public. The visual aspect is critical; observing a leader's demeanor, their energy levels, and their non-verbal cues can offer invaluable insights into their state of mind and their commitment to a particular issue. A live video Trump Zelensky would be scrutinized for every subtle cue, every flicker of expression, as these can be interpreted as indicators of underlying political positions or personal relationships.

However, the reliance on live video also presents challenges. Technical glitches, internet connectivity issues, and the lack of physical presence can hinder effective communication. The absence of informal 'corridor diplomacy' – the spontaneous conversations that occur at international summits – can mean that opportunities for building personal rapport and finding common ground are missed. Furthermore, the visual nature of live video means that appearances and presentation can sometimes overshadow substance, with leaders potentially playing to the cameras rather than engaging in genuine dialogue. A live video Trump Zelensky would undoubtedly be a highly public event, and both leaders might be acutely aware of the global audience, potentially influencing their behavior and their willingness to engage in frank discussions. The pressure to deliver a 'winning' performance or to project an image of unwavering resolve could also impede genuine negotiation.
